  • Original language description

    Military pilot education, including flight training is a long, expensive and complex process. The main goal is to produce as many skilled professionals ready to perform flight tasks on the front-line aircraft and push them to the limits with complete control. To achieve this goal it is necessary to select and educate young people with aptitude and abilities to perform the most demanding military flight tasks. The creation of a model for the education and training of military pilots depends on the requirements of Air Force Command and the teaching capacities of the University of Defense and the Aviation Training Center in Pardubice. Rearmament of the Air Force of the Czech Republic and the required number of pilots at the exit requires a change in the model of training military pilots. This contribution describes a possible model of teaching military pilots in the current conditions of the University of Defense.
